과정 세부사항

• Fundamentals of Clean Energy: An overview of clean energy sources and their importance in the global energy landscape.
• Introduction to Nanotechnology: A basic understanding of nanotechnology and its applications in various fields.
• Nanotechnology in Solar Energy: The use of nanotechnology to improve the efficiency and affordability of solar energy systems.
• Nanomaterials for Energy Storage: The role of nanomaterials in developing advanced energy storage solutions, such as batteries and capacitors.
• Nanotechnology in Fuel Cells: The application of nanotechnology in improving the efficiency and durability of fuel cells.
• Nanotechnology in Wind Energy: The use of nanotechnology to enhance the performance and reduce the cost of wind energy systems.
• Environmental Impact of Nanotechnology in Clean Energy: An examination of the potential environmental benefits and risks associated with the use of nanotechnology in clean energy.
• Emerging Trends and Future Directions: An exploration of the latest developments and future prospects of nanotechnology in clean energy.
• Ethical and Societal Implications: A discussion on the ethical and societal implications of the widespread adoption of nanotechnology in clean energy.
• Research Methods and Project Management: Techniques and best practices for conducting research and managing projects in the field of nanotechnology and clean energy.

경력 경로

Nanotechnology Engineer: A nanotechnology engineer focuses on developing and designing nanoscale materials, systems, and devices for clean energy applications. They require a strong background in engineering, physics, and chemistry. In the UK, nanotechnology engineers can earn an average salary of ÂŁ40,000 to ÂŁ70,000 per year. Clean Energy Consultant: A clean energy consultant supports businesses and organizations in their transition to clean energy technologies and practices. They need expertise in energy policy, sustainability, and business management. In the UK, clean energy consultants can earn an average salary of ÂŁ30,000 to ÂŁ60,000 per year. Material Scientist: A material scientist studies the properties, composition, and structure of various materials, including those used in clean energy applications. They require a strong foundation in physics, chemistry, and mathematics. In the UK, material scientists can earn an average salary of ÂŁ25,000 to ÂŁ55,000 per year. Nanotechnology Researcher: A nanotechnology researcher investigates nanoscale phenomena and develops nanotechnology for various applications, including clean energy. They need a background in physics, chemistry, or engineering. In the UK, nanotechnology researchers can earn an average salary of ÂŁ30,000 to ÂŁ60,000 per year.
